Output 0651143286ef91b616a3b4a3cbed8be04f0a9386ad6875672efbd4640340872e:3

value
565877
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d024ace259c65370809fa6ff5354e08c8629ed0 OP_EQUAL
address
3D618nexrrKnrJL5aGkf7TWgzh6qJ1PCMj
transaction
0651143286ef91b616a3b4a3cbed8be04f0a9386ad6875672efbd4640340872e